Recipe Description

This Classic Vegan Salade Marocaine brings the essence of Moroccan cuisine right to your table, offering a refreshing mix of crisp vegetables, olives, and herbs, all dressed in a vibrant lemon and olive oil vinaigrette. Perfect for those seeking a light but flavorful meal, it embodies the simplicity and freshness Moroccan salads are renowned for. Ideal as a starter or a side dish, this salad not only caters to vegan and dairy-free diets but also introduces an authentic taste of Moroccan culture. Its ingredients, easily found in any kitchen, make it a go-to recipe for a quick, nutritious, and delicious dish.

Ingredients

  • 1 cucumber, diced
  • 2 tomatoes, diced
  • 1 red onion, thinly sliced
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 3 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• 1/2 cup pitted green olives, halved

Steps:

  1. In a large bowl, combine cucumber, tomatoes, red onion, cilantro, and parsley.
  2. In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  3. Pour dressing over the salad and toss to coat evenly.
  4. Gently fold in green olives.
  5. Ch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es before serving to allow flavors to meld.
